qualifications

英 [ˌkwɒlɪfɪˈkeɪʃənz]

美 [ˌkwɑləfəˈkeɪʃənz]

n.  (通过考试或学习课程取得的)资格; 学历; (通过经验或具备技能而取得的)资格; 资历; 限定条件
qualification的复数

  • He left school with no qualifications
    他没有获得任何学历证书便离开了学校。
  • I only had the minimum qualifications, but luck was with me.
    我只具有最起码的资格,但我侥幸成功了。
  • They will be encouraged to mix academic A-levels with vocational qualifications
    将鼓励他们在取得优秀学习成绩的同时也要获得一定的职业资质。
  • We're looking for people who have experience rather than paper qualifications.
    我们要找有经验的人,而不是有文凭的人。
